At eight thirty that morning, all the campers and counselors lined up in front of the mess hall for breakfast. Brady was waiting impatiently when one of his campers approached him. "Hey Brady, do you think we could sit with 'our girls' today? Y'know, Chloe and Belle's girls. Share a table and everything? I wanted to talk to my best friend Vanessa, and Jeff wants to talk to her too, and David K. wants to talk to his girlfriend, and…" Brady nodded, cutting him off. "No problem Ben. We were going to ask to sit with them anyway." Ben smiled. "Alright!"
After Dean finally let them go inside, Brady, Shawn, and some of their guys came up to Chloe and Belle's 'table.' "Hello ladies. We were wondering if any of you lovely young women would come and sit with us." Brady asked, leaning closely to Chloe. "These guys want to sit with their 'friends.'" He whispered. Chloe smiled, remembering how Shawn and Belle used to always say, we're just friends. "Yeah, come and sit next to me." She said, pulling Brady into the chair next to her.
"So Jeff. How does it feel to be beat by a girl?" Jessica asked, reminding him off the football game. "It hurts." He joked, showing off his bruises. Chloe laughed, enjoying breakfast.
Just as breakfast was coming to and end, Chloe turned and saw someone enter the crowded room. There was no way she could miss them. "I can't believe it!"
Mimi sat across from Jason, watching him as he stared at the door intently. "Anxious?" She asked, breaking his train of thought. "Oh, no. I just figured my friend woulda gotten her before now." Mimi smiled. "I'm sure they're just stuck in traffic." She encouraged. "Yeah." He said, his eyes trailing back to the door. Suddenly a smile appeared on his face, and Mimi followed his gaze to the door. A beautiful brunette appeared.
Jan walked into the crowded mess hall, and walked straight to Jason's table. "Hey Jase." She grinned, coming up behind him and wrapping her arms around him tightly. "Hey Jan." He replied, standing up next to her and giving her a hug.
After catching up with her, he introduced Mimi. "Jan, those are your girls over here, and this is your co-counselor Mimi Lockhart. I'm sure you guys'll get along great. Oh, and Chloe's over there with Brady if you want to go and say hi to her." Jan grinned, giving Mimi her hand. "Hey, I'm Jan." She introduced herself. "I'm your new co-counselor." Mimi looked up from her plate, looking up at the girl who stood smiling brightly in front of her. She's seemed really likeable. "Hey Jan. I'm Mimi. It's really nice to meet you." Jan smiled, sitting down at the table. She knew she liked Mimi already. "So Jan, how long have you known Jason?" Jan threw her head back and laughed. "All of my life." "Oh, are you his sister or something? Is that why you owe him?" Jan laughed. "He didn't tell you? I'm his girlfriend!"
